Detailed Accounts

Selected Case Summaries

These summaries are drawn from real engagements, with identifying details changed.

Challenge

A retired British couple, long-term Phuket residents, had no Thai wills. Their assets included a condominium and significant bank savings. They were unsure whether their home-country wills would cover the Thai property.

What We Did

We prepared separate Thai wills for each spouse, explained the scope of Thai probate relative to their foreign wills, and drafted a summary note for their UK solicitor. Two meetings over three weeks.

Result

Both clients left with valid Thai wills, a clear understanding of how their estate would be handled, and a document their UK solicitor could work alongside. The matter was concluded in 3 weeks.

"We had been meaning to sort this out for years. It turned out to be far simpler than we expected."

Challenge

A Thai woman inherited a share of her father's land from an estate without a will. Three siblings were involved, one living abroad, and there was disagreement about the division. Probate was required.

What We Did

We managed the probate application, liaised with the overseas sibling's local representative, and prepared all court documentation. Each phase was explained in writing before proceeding.

Result

Probate concluded after approximately six months. The land was formally divided according to the court order. All three siblings accepted the outcome without further dispute.
